Properties
Melting point :>280°C
Density :2.435
vapor pressure :0Pa at 25℃
storage temp. :Refrigerator
solubility :Slightly soluble in water, very slightly soluble in ethanol (96 per cent).
form :solid
color :Dark Red to Dark Brown
Water Solubility :Soluble in water (0.14 g/100 ml at 25°C).
Merck :14,4046
Exposure limits :ACGIH: TWA 1 mg/m3
NIOSH: TWA 1 mg/m3 Stability :Stability
InChIKey :PMVSDNDAUGGCCE-TYYBGVCCSA-L
LogP :0.62
CAS DataBase Reference :141-01-5(CAS DataBase Reference)
EPA Substance Registry System :2-Butenedioic acid (2E)-, iron(2+) salt (1:1) (141-01-5)

Description
Ferrous fumarate is the ferrous salt form of fumarate. One of its most important applications is being used as iron supplements for the treatment of iron deficiency and anemia. It has been demonstrated that application of ferrous sulfate drops or a single daily dose of microencapsulated ferrous fumarate sprinkles plus ascorbic acid both result in successful treatment of anemia without remarkable side effects.
